UNUS SED LEO in brief
Indicator | Value | Analysis |
---|---|---|
🌐 Blockchain of origin | Ethereum (ERC-20), also Sora | Main deployment on Ethereum ensures high compatibility and liquidity. |
💼 Project type | Exchange Utility Token | Designed to provide benefits within Bitfinex and iFinex ecosystem. |
🏛️ Date of creation | May 2019 | Mid-2019 launch provides a significant operational track record. |
🏢 Market capitalization | $8.39 billion (as of 7 June 2025) | Ranks as a top utility token by market capitalization. |
📊 Market cap rank | #22 (approximate, June 2025) | Among the largest crypto assets, reflecting strong investor interest. |
📈 24h trading volume | $4.06 million | Moderate liquidity; volume is solid for a non-Layer 1 token. |
💹 Total circulating tokens | 923.3 million LEO | Supply decreasing due to continuous buy-back and burn mechanism. |
💡 Main objective | Reduce Bitfinex trading fees and strengthen the iFinex ecosystem. | Utility token tightly linked to Bitfinex’s financial performance. |

Spot Purchase
Buying UNUS SED LEO on the spot market means you acquire real LEO tokens, which are stored in your crypto wallet (either on the exchange or in your own private wallet). With spot buying, you own the actual asset, giving you full control over your coins and the possibility to use them within the iFinex ecosystem (e.g., for trading fee discounts on Bitfinex).
Typical fees: Most crypto platforms charge a fixed commission per transaction, usually between 0.1% and 1.5% of your purchase, applied in EUR.
Example
Suppose the current price of UNUS SED LEO is $9.08 USD (approx. €8.40 at a €1 = $1.08 exchange rate). With an investment of €1,000, you can buy about 119 LEO coins, factoring in an estimated €5 transaction fee.
- Profit scenario:
- If the price of UNUS SED LEO rises by 10%, your holding is now worth €1,100.
- Result: €100 gross gain, representing a +10% return on your investment.
Trading via CFD
Trading UNUS SED LEO via contracts for difference (CFDs) allows you to speculate on its price movements without owning the actual coins. With CFDs, you open a position with a broker and profit from price changes in either direction (long or short). CFDs typically offer leverage, amplifying both gains and losses.
Fees: You pay the spread (the difference between the buy and sell price), and—if you hold a position overnight—an additional daily financing fee.
Example
You open a CFD on LEO with €1,000 and use 5x leverage, giving you €5,000 exposure to the crypto market.
- Profit scenario:
- If UNUS SED LEO increases by 8%, your position grows by 8% × 5 = 40%.
- Result: €400 gain on your €1,000 margin (excluding fees).

The ongoing deflationary token burn linked to Bitfinex’s revenues continues to reduce LEO's circulating supply. At least 27% of iFinex’s consolidated monthly revenues are consistently allocated to buybacks and permanent destruction of LEO tokens, a robust mechanism which, along with the recent reduction of more than 66.3 million tokens since launch, is widely viewed as a significant positive for long-term token value. This feature, combined with the use of 80% of funds recovered from the 2016 Bitfinex hack for further buybacks, underscores the token's built-in scarcity, a dynamic particularly noted by institutional and retail investors in mature markets like Ireland.

What is the latest staking yield for UNUS SED LEO?
Currently, UNUS SED LEO does not offer a native staking mechanism. Token holders cannot earn rewards through traditional staking on the main platforms, including Bitfinex or Binance. Instead, LEO’s value for investors comes mainly from its token utility (such as trading fee discounts) and its robust deflationary “burn” mechanism, which regularly reduces the supply of tokens. This ongoing burn is directly linked to Bitfinex revenues and plays a central role in supporting the token's price over time.

What is the tax treatment of cryptocurrency capital gains in Ireland, and does it apply to UNUS SED LEO?
In Ireland, gains from the sale or exchange of cryptoassets—including UNUS SED LEO—are subject to Capital Gains Tax (CGT) at a rate of 33%. Any disposal of crypto, such as selling LEO for euros or exchanging it for another token, triggers a taxable event. All gains above the annual CGT exemption (€1,270 per individual) must be declared in your annual tax return. Holding periods do not affect the rate, and there are currently no specific exemptions for cryptocurrencies in Ireland.
